Award-Winning Violinist Finishes Father’s Piece That Nazis Broke Up
Join the forum discussion on this postFrom The World Post: RAANANA, Israel (AP) — In 1933, the promising young Jewish-German violinist Ernest Drucker left the stage midway through a Brahms concerto in Cologne at the behest of Nazi officials, in … Continue reading

Violinist unearths mystery behind her 345-year-old violin
Join the forum discussion on this postFrom Tuscon.com/Arizona Daily Star: Chee-Yun plunked down a small fortune for her 1669 Francesco Ruggieri violin, an instrument whose provenance was a mystery. The seller offered no list of violinists who had played it. … Continue reading
